Joseph allard february 1, 1873 november 14, 1947 was a quebec fiddler who made many popular recordings earning him the title the prince of fiddlers. Departing from the usual structure of most angloceltic tunes, sometimes radically, frenchcanadian tunes are often seen as crooked by other traditions standards. Jean carignan, cm december 7, 1916 february 16, 1988 was a canadian fiddler from quebec carignan was born in levis, quebec on december 7, 1916, later moving to sherbrooke and then troisrivieres with his family.
